Gtx 770 Launch And Specifications
The GTX 770 was officially launched by NVIDIA in May 2013 as a high-performance graphics card catering to gaming enthusiasts and professionals alike. Boasting impressive specifications for its time, the GTX 770 featured the Kepler GK104 GPU architecture and 1536 CUDA cores, delivering substantial computational power for graphics-intensive tasks.
With a base clock speed of 1046 MHz and a boost clock of 1085 MHz, the GTX 770 offered excellent gaming performance and was capable of running modern titles at high settings with smooth frame rates. The card came equipped with 2 GB of GDDR5 memory on a 256-bit memory interface, providing ample bandwidth for handling demanding visual effects and textures without compromising on speed or quality.

How To Check Gtx 770’S Actual Memory Capacity
To verify the actual memory capacity of your GTX 770 graphics card, you can follow a simple process using software utilities. One popular tool is GPU-Z, a free application that provides detailed information about your GPU, including memory size and clock speeds. By downloading GPU-Z and running it while your GTX 770 is in use, you can easily confirm the exact memory capacity of your graphics card.
Another method to check the GTX 770’s memory capacity is through the NVIDIA Control Panel. Right-click on your desktop and select the NVIDIA Control Panel from the menu. Within the control panel, navigate to the System Information section, where you can find comprehensive details about your graphics card, including the memory size. This direct method offers a quick way to access crucial information about your GTX 770’s memory capacity without the need for third-party software.

FAQ
What Is The Gb Capacity Of The Gtx 770?
The NVIDIA GeForce GTX 770 typically comes with either 2GB or 4GB of GDDR5 memory. The 2GB version is more common, offering sufficient capacity for most gaming needs and general computing tasks. However, the 4GB variant provides extra headroom for higher resolution gaming, multi-monitor setups, and more demanding applications that benefit from additional graphics memory. Ultimately, the choice between the 2GB and 4GB models depends on the user’s specific requirements and budget considerations.
How Does The Gb Capacity Of The Gtx 770 Compare To Other Graphics Cards?
The GTX 770 typically has a VRAM capacity of 2GB or 4GB, which was considered decent when it was released in 2013. However, compared to newer graphics cards on the market today, such as the GTX 1060 or GTX 1660, which offer 6GB or 8GB of VRAM, the GTX 770’s capacity might fall short when running more modern and demanding games or applications. It is still a capable card for older games or basic tasks, but its VRAM capacity may limit its performance when handling more recent, graphics-intensive tasks.
